Subject: DR drill Thursday — LargeDiff service

Reviewers: we're failing over LargeDiff (the big-file diff viewer) to the Karsten region Thursday 09:00. Expect chunked-diff rendering to be slow for ~20 min. Hold approvals on diffs over 50MB during the window. Merge queue stays open. If the standby index fails to warm, restore it from the sealed snapshot; the snapshot archive unlocks with the passphrase below.

vault phrase of bagaf-kajeg = jorath-feniel-briir-siliel-ralix

# Annual Billing Transition — Managers Only

Tornquist Labs moves all Fernbeck subscriptions to annual billing next quarter. Monthly plans close to new signups immediately. Existing customers migrate at renewal; grandfathering ends after two cycles. Expect churn pressure in the SMB tier — retention scripts are in the playbook. Revenue recognition changes are with the accounting group. For the incoming director: the rationale ties directly to the strategy summarised below.

internal memo for tajof-kaduf: Only 65 of the 511 pilot accounts renewed Lamdor, so a churn review is set for January 26. Aldmirek Works is in early talks to buy Alddorox Works for about $490.9 million.

Plugin authors: your scaling hooks run inside the decision loop, so keep them fast — anything over 200ms is skipped and logged. Common issues: hooks returning non-numeric weights, and plugins assuming per-queue state survives restarts (it doesn't). Check the `hooks.log` output before filing anything; most reports are config errors. Include your plugin version, the queue name, and a depth graph screenshot with any report. For plugin API questions or bug reports, contact the maintainers here.

escalation mailbox, bafog-fafog: ulador@paliqlabs.internal

Ticket: Bounceloop worker fails to connect intermittently. Since the Fenwick migration, the bounce processor drops its pool connection roughly every six hours, usually mid-batch. Retries succeed after a cold restart, suggesting stale sockets rather than credential issues. Please verify the pool's idle timeout against the server's. The staging database it should target is below.

warehouse DSN: clickhouse://druys_svc:Pl@db-47e1.orvexstack.corp:5432/beldor